About Ethics and Professional Responsibility Law in Mariestad, Sweden
Ethics and Professional Responsibility law governs the standards and conduct expected of professionals, especially those in regulated fields such as law, healthcare, and finance, in Mariestad, Sweden. These standards ensure public trust, maintain the integrity of professions, and provide frameworks for resolving conflicts of interest or allegations of misconduct. In Mariestad, as in the rest of Sweden, the core principles come from national legislation, complemented by local and sector-specific rules. Professional associations often set additional ethical expectations which members are required to follow.

Local Laws Overview
Mariestad abides by Swedish national laws regulating professional conduct, such as the Penal Code, the Public Access to Information and Secrecy Act, and sector-specific statutes like those governing lawyers (Advokatsamfundet regulations), healthcare professionals, and civil servants. These laws define obligations such as confidentiality, impartiality, proper record-keeping, and the avoidance of conflicts of interest. Local authorities in Mariestad also implement internal guidelines and may investigate reported breaches of ethical or professional standards. In disciplinary matters, local branches of national professional bodies often take the lead, ensuring both compliance with national norms and consideration of local circumstances.
Frequently Asked Questions
What is considered professional misconduct in Mariestad?
Professional misconduct generally refers to actions that violate the ethical standards set for a specific profession, such as breaching client confidentiality, falsifying records, or conflicts of interest. Swedish law and professional bodies provide detailed guidelines on this.
Who regulates professional conduct in Mariestad?
Professional conduct is regulated by national authorities, such as the Swedish Bar Association for lawyers and the Health and Social Care Inspectorate for healthcare workers, along with local branches and employer guidelines.
Can I file a complaint about a professional in Mariestad?
Yes, individuals can file complaints with the relevant professional body or local authority if they believe a professional has breached ethical or professional conduct obligations.
What happens if I am accused of professional misconduct?
If accused, you may face a disciplinary investigation by your professional body or employer. You have the right to present your side, and in many cases, seek legal representation for your defense.
Are there specific ethical standards for public officials in Mariestad?
Yes, public officials must follow both national laws and local codes of conduct, focusing on impartiality, transparency, and the prohibition of conflicts of interest.
How can I check if a professional in Mariestad is in good standing?
You can usually contact the relevant professional association or authority to verify whether a professional is currently licensed and in good standing without recent disciplinary actions.
Is confidentiality always legally binding in Sweden?
While confidentiality is a crucial aspect of many professions, Swedish law provides exceptions, such as in cases involving the prevention of serious crime. Always consult a lawyer for specific advice.
What are common consequences of a breach of professional responsibility?
Consequences may include reprimands, suspension or loss of license, fines, or legal action depending on the severity of the breach and the professional standards applicable.
What is a conflict of interest and how should it be managed?
A conflict of interest arises when personal interests could improperly influence professional judgment. It must be disclosed and managed according to the rules of the relevant professional body or employer regulations.

Additional Resources
If you need more information or assistance, you can contact:
- The Swedish Bar Association (Sveriges Advokatsamfund) for legal professionals
- Health and Social Care Inspectorate (Inspektionen för vård och omsorg, IVO) for healthcare matters
- Swedish Data Protection Authority (Integritetsskyddsmyndigheten) for issues related to confidentiality and privacy
- The Municipality of Mariestad (Mariestads kommun) for local regulations and procedures involving municipal employees and services
- Consumer Protection Agency (Konsumentverket) for issues impacting the general public and client rights
These organizations provide guidelines, complaint forms, and often direct support or referrals to specialized legal professionals.
